Now you are leaving the camp your monthly allowance is N19800. Some working class citizen/graduate do not earn such amount, see it as a big money even if it is chicken change to you, assume/pretend it’s a huge sum and spend it jealously because this money can earn you good fortune. Here are the ways to spend your money jealously 1. set a target: Set a target on the amount you want to save monthly from your allowance 5000, 8000, 10000. Do the calculation yourself and see how much you’ll earn during your service year. You can even save beyond 10000 if you are posted to a village. 2. Understand the different between want and need: that you want something does not mean you need it at the moment. After receiving the first allowance some corpers will go for irrelevant things like expensive (more than half of their allowance) phone, shoes, iPhone out of the allowance. There is nothing wrong with this but before going for these. Think! (Will this stuff be an asset or liability) if it will serve as an asset, good! Go for it. If otherwise ignore it and discipline yourself. It is a known fact that as you grow older your toy becomes expensive but you need to be careful and make use of good your scale of preference. 3. Control your eating habit: don’t eat anyhow, eating from a canteen where a plate of food is 200 and you don’t cook, you eat there. If l assumes you eat twice in a day that is 400 per day for a month you have spent 12000 on feeding alone. You are left with 7800, there are other needs. So buy food stuff, stove, pot etc with your first allowance. If you don’t know how to cook, that is not a crime, meet your mates in the lodge they’ll put you through and you’ll see it as an opportunity to learn. I spent my service year eating what l wants not what l sees. I cooked and eat decent food. 4. Self dependent: it is good to be friendly but don’t let friends take advantage of you. I know of a lodge where corpers will contribute money to a girl, just for cooking. It is not wrong but don’t make it a regular thing there are differences between” I OWN ‘ and” WE OWN”. Buy what you’ll need and keep it jealously. By the time you buy foods stuff together and there you have a female corper to cook, that is where deliberation of what to eat starts coming in, you wait for someone at times before everyone eat. Just like partnership in business. Except you can be mature enough to handle it, do not settle for that. 5.falling in lust: don’t date your fellow corper if you know it will not lead to marriage as most of them will help you spend your money and keep their own in the name of love. Don’t be deceived! You can imagine! Paying someone recharge card money, hairdresser’s money, cloth money, body cream money, feeding a guy that claimed he did not receive alert., the list is endless…he/she may have a fiancé you are just an assistance boyfriend/girlfriend. And for some smart guys they’ll eat the girl dry and complain of being a debtor. If you believe you can save 10000 with a corper girlfriend/boyfriend and you are the one taking care of the financial aspect. Then you’ll believe it, if l say shekau will become pope in Rome. It is a game there must be a loser. 6. Skills: these are the things you should have discovered in yourself before leaving school. God have settled every one of us. You either acquire skills or you have inborn skills. So develop it, all you need is packaging. I earn what my three month allowance will not yield in a month when l used my skills. Even though l said earlier that you should assume that N19800 is a huge amount. Think of earning more than that in a month on your own. How? Mind your own business. 7. Grow up: you are not a kid again forget your age, do not deceive yourself. Stop calling your parent for help financially stand on your own, take responsibility of your own action and they will be proud of you. You will also feel fulfilled and believe that the future, is for you to manage and not your parent. 8. Inferiority complex: IC is when with your 19800 Monthly allowance without other source of income. You are saving to buy iphone, phantom A etc..to replace you android/nokia phone. You feel your fellow corpers eat chicken everyday and that is what you want too.(oloju kokoro) You want other corper to rate you high compare to anyone in spending. Don’t live a nollywood actor/actress life style. I call it borrowed life style. That doesn’t mean you shouldn’t aim high. 9. BUSINESS: If you can manage that 19800k for your needs and business, if you get 19.8B managing it and establishing a reliable business will not be hard, but if with this little money, you can do nothing then you will fail even if you have the whole world. At times I borrow my allowance for business and I make sure I return it in due time. 10. HELP PEOPLE: Be eager to help people financially, physically even spiritually. Don’t be stingy, especially your sibling and parent. That you have today does no guaranty that you will have tomorrow. Do these and you will earn their respect. It has been working for me, when I give, I get in return. With these steps I was able to save my N19800 for each month during my service days. I never for one day regrets doing what l did then. Thank you for giving me your time. Abifarin bukola P. aka Sure Way Graduated from futminna Batch A 2013 Served in karaye local gov’t Kano state. |
